We are supporting a well-established international engineering and service provider within the wind energy sector in the search for a Head of Sales to lead commercial activity across Europe and APAC.

 

This is a senior leadership position focused on driving growth across both onshore and offshore wind markets, with approximately 60% of the business centred around onshore wind and 40% offshore. The organisation already has a strong reputation within the market, an established customer base and long-term framework agreements in place, but is looking for someone capable of taking the commercial function to the next level.
